Leash Law was an American power metal band formed by ex-members of various other groups. It was formed in 2003 by Wade Black, once a member of the band Seven Witches, Rick Renstrom, Emo Mowery, Stephen Elder, and Richard Christy, who was once a member of the influential bands Death and Iced Earth. In 2004, Leash Law released their first and only album, Dogface. The band disbanded in 2005.
